Jerónimo Lobo’s ‘A Voyage to Abyssinia’ is a compelling account of his travels through the mysterious and enigmatic land of Abyssinia, now known as Ethiopia. Written in a clear and straightforward style, the book provides valuable insights into the culture, politics, and geography of the region during the 17th century. Lobo’s vivid descriptions of the people he encounters, the landscapes he traverses, and the customs he observes make this travelogue a fascinating read for anyone interested in African history and exploration. The narrative is rich in detail and offers a unique perspective on a little-known part of the world. Lobo’s firsthand experiences bring the reader closer to the realities of Abyssinian life, shedding light on a complex and intriguing society. Jerónimo Lobo’s background as a Jesuit missionary and his deep knowledge of the region make him a reliable and insightful guide through this captivating journey.
